Closed Bug 1579935 Opened 7 months ago Closed 5 months ago

WebExt API: Add browser.experiments.urlbar.restartBrowser call

Categories

(Firefox :: Address Bar, enhancement, P2)

enhancement
Points:
3

Tracking

()

RESOLVED FIXED
Firefox 72
Iteration:
72.2 - Nov 4 - 17
Tracking Status
firefox72 --- fixed

People

(Reporter: harry, Assigned: mak)

References

(Blocks 1 open bug)

Details

Attachments

(1 file)

This call updates Firefox. We should decide if calling this when there is no update staged is either a no-op, or stages and then installs the update.

See appUpdate.buttonRestartAfterDownload().

Priority: -- → P2
Summary: WebExt API: Add browser.app.updateBrowser call → WebExt API: Add browser.experiments.app.updateBrowser call
Assignee: nobody → mak
Iteration: --- → 72.2 - Nov 4 - 17
No longer blocks: 1579933
Status: NEW → ASSIGNED
Summary: WebExt API: Add browser.experiments.app.updateBrowser call → WebExt API: Add browser.experiments.urlbar.updateBrowser call

This should be a restartBrowser function, which we'll call when an update is staged. After restart, the browser will be updated.

Summary: WebExt API: Add browser.experiments.urlbar.updateBrowser call → WebExt API: Add browser.experiments.urlbar.restartBrowser call

Yep, it should be.

Pushed by mak77@bonardo.net:
https://hg.mozilla.org/integration/autoland/rev/94f7a6826478
WebExt API: Add browser.experiments.urlbar.restartBrowser. r=adw,mixedpuppy
Status: ASSIGNED → RESOLVED
Closed: 5 months ago
Resolution: --- → FIXED
Target Milestone: --- → Firefox 72
You need to log in before you can comment on or make changes to this bug.